Courtesan imitating courtier Kneeling courtesan

Courtesan imitating courtier, Kneeling courtesan in court clothes, in left hand a fan on which poem written with brush in left hand accompanied by kamuro, standing with sword and courtesan, standing with hand above eyes, looking towards Mount Fuji, whose foot is visible in the background. Left sheet of triptych. Kitagawa Utamaro (mentioned on object), Japan, 1795 - 1800, paper, colour woodcut, h 365 mm × w 251 mm

EDITORS COMMENTS
This print by Kitagawa Utamaro transports us to the vibrant world of 18th-century Japan. In this left sheet of a triptych, we witness a mesmerizing scene featuring a courtesan imitating a courtier and a kneeling courtesan adorned in exquisite court clothes. Utamaro's meticulous attention to detail is evident as he portrays the courtesan holding a delicate fan in her left hand, upon which a poem is elegantly written with a brush. Accompanied by her kamuro, she stands gracefully with an air of elegance and poise. Beside her stands another figure, wielding a sword symbolizing power and strength. As our gaze follows their line of sight, we are drawn towards the majestic Mount Fuji looming in the background. Its serene presence adds depth and tranquility to the composition while reminding us of Japan's awe-inspiring natural beauty. The use of color woodcut technique brings vibrancy to every element within the print, enhancing its visual impact. Utamaro's mastery shines through as he captures not only intricate details but also emotions that emanate from each character portrayed. This artwork offers us an intimate glimpse into Japanese culture during this period, where social hierarchies were carefully observed and aesthetics played an essential role. It invites contemplation on themes such as identity, imitation versus authenticity, and societal expectations.
